Headquartered in Perth, Australia, with offices globally, Qoria is an ASX listed global leader in child digital safety technology and services. We are a purpose-driven business, operating under the 'Linewize' brand in North America and Asia Pacific, the 'Smoothwall' brand in the UK, and the 'Qoria' brand in EMEA and Sri Lanka. Our solutions are utilised by schools, school districts, and parental communities to protect children from seeing harmful content online, identify children at risk based on their digital behaviours and ensure teachers maintain focus and safe learning in the digital classroom schools and 7 million parents depend on our solutions to keep 25 million children safe in 180 countries around the world.

Product Business Analyst
to help unify Qoria's platform and deliver a seamless experience for our users. You'll work across product, engineering, and operations to align priorities, streamline user journeys, and extend platform capabilities — ensuring every initiative delivers measurable business value.

Here's how you'll do it:

  • Act as a bridge between business goals and technical execution across squads in Australia, Sri Lanka, and beyond.
  • Support product discovery, backlog management, and delivery planning for shared services and unified platform initiatives.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to validate needs, align workflows, and consolidate insights into actionable recommendations.
  • Map systems and design user flows to simplify complex journeys across multiple products.
  • Define success metrics, analyse impact, and share clear documentation to drive adoption of shared components across teams.
  • Track and manage dependencies across product, operations, and engineering squads.

What you'll bring:

  • 5+ years' experience as a Business Analyst, ideally in product, technical, or transformation roles.
  • Strong collaboration skills with cross-functional and cross-regional teams.
  • Proven stakeholder negotiation and conflict resolution experience.
  • Confidence working with ambiguity, shifting requirements, and emerging technologies.
  • Familiarity with agile methods (Scrum, Kanban, or hybrid).
  • Ability to translate between business flows and technical systems.
  • Excellent communication, documentation, and stakeholder management skills.
  • Bonus: experience with platform teams, tools like Miro/Lucidchart, and systems like Jira, Confluence, or Airtable.
